A kilt is defined as a knee-length skirt with deep pleats, usually of a tartan wool, worn as part of
the dress for men in the Scottish Highlands. It is known as the national dress for Scotland. Women, boys, and girls
also wear kilts. We haven't pubicly seen William and Harry in kilts in recent years but we know they often
wore them while they were with their family in Balmoral Castle, Scotland. For more information on kilts go
